Designing Your Life
The course uses design thinking to address the “wicked problem” of designing your life and career. This class offers a framework, tools, and most importantly a place and a community of peers and mentors where we’ll work on these issues through assigned readings, reflections, and in-class exercises. The course employs a design thinking approach to help students from any major navigate the challenges of their twenty-something “Odyssey Years” and develop a constructive and effective approach to finding and designing their vocation after Stanford. The course incorporates basic instruction in an introduction to design thinking and particularly a design point of view. Further, we provide a framework that organizes the content elements of the course, including the integration of work and worldview, the realities of engaging the workplace, and practices that support vocation formation throughout your life. The course deals with issues ranging from how to find and experience meaning-making in work to how to network and get an interview. Small group dialogue will be held in regular sections comprised of a group of peers. Course objectives are to assist students to: • Learn an essential overview of design thinking and a design point of view. • Learn a framework that supports vocation development, now and in the future. • Acquire methods for discovering and designing career and life. • Develop a concept of a coherent, successful life to guide career choices. • Clearly position their education and background in the marketplace • Integrate their career experiences with their own vocational vision. • Develop a preliminary post-graduation plan/vision (“Odyssey Years Plan”) ***Description borrowed from Stanford Design Program***
